James Cameron Bolsters Support for Paramount-Warner Bros. Merger, Says Ellison-Run Mega-Studio 'Doesn't Bother Me at All'
Just as thousands of his industry peers are raising calls to block Paramount's $111 billion acquisition of Warner Bros. Discovery, "Avatar" and "Titanic" filmmaker James Cameron doubled down on his support of the merger, telling the Associated Press, "I'm a supporter of it. I know it's controversial."
